Center, Orlando Magic agree on 2-year, $21 million deal

Center, Orlando Magic agree on 2-year, $21 million deal

Free agent center Mo Bamba has reached an agreement with the Orlando Magic on a two-year, $21 million deal, his agents Mark Bartelstein and Greer Love of Priority Sports told Yahoo Sports. The Magic did not extend a qualifying offer to Bamba, but they were able to negotiate a new deal. Multiple teams reportedly had interest in Bamba, the sixth overall pick in the 2018 NBA draft, who had the best season of his career last year. Paolo Banchero selected with No. 1 overall pick by Orlando Magic

Paolo Banchero selected with No. 1 overall pick by Orlando Magic

NEW YORK — The Orlando Magic selected Duke forward Paolo Banchero with the first pick in the 2022 NBA draft on Thursday night. After weeks of Auburn’s Jabari Smith being projected as the consensus top pick, the Magic shocked everyone by selecting Banchero. Banchero is the second No. 1 pick in the last four years for the Blue Devils (Zion Williamson went No. 1 to the New Orleans Pelicans in 2019), and the fifth top overall pick in program history.
